When aiming to acquire a home, it is unlikely that customers will certainly yield enough info on the homes internal workings with a simple walkthrough. Inspections can assist to recognize any number of possible deal breakers with a residential or commercial property, consisting of: Pests & animal invasions (termites, rats, and so on) Fungi, mold and mildew, and allergens Air high quality and heating and cooling systems Architectural concerns Problem of roofing, home windows, doors, etc.


A home evaluation record may present potential negotiating chances for customers. While vendors are not assured to follow up with a request, recognizing the threats of a residential property can offer purchasers a means of recognizing the true problem of the property and a feasible way to save cash when purchasing a home.

A home assessment is an evaluation of the physical condition of a home.


Plus they will certainly analyze systems like pipes, electrical, home heating and air conditioning, as well as any built-in devices. The examiner will certainly provide you a created record, and the record may consist of approximated costs for repairs and replacements. The examiner will not inform you whether you ought to buy your house.
